Grunt js คืออะไร หาคำตอบได้ที่นี่  สร้างคำถาม

 1,902 view  หมวดหมู่ : สำหรับโปรแกรมเมอร์  วันที่สร้าง : 30/09/2015

Grunt js คืออะไร หาคำตอบได้ที่นี่

Grunt JS เป็น Package เสริมตัวหนึ่งของ Node JS
ก่อนที่เราจะใช้งาน Grunt JS ได้เราต้องลง Node JS
แล้ว ลง NPM ไว้ก่อน จากนั้น ติดตั้ง Grunt JS ได้ด้วยคำสั่งง่ายๆเลย

npm install -g grunt-cli

Grunt JSเป็น JavaScript Task Runner ทำหน้าที่เป็นคล้ายๆ util คอยช่วยให้เราทำงานได้เร็วขึ้น
เช่นการจัดระเบียบไฟล์ พวก CSS , javascript งานถิปาถะต่างๆ พวก ขนาดไฟล์ พวกกำจัดขยะที่ไม่ได้ใช้ เป็นต้น
โดย Grunt JS มี plugin ให้เรียกใช้เยอะมาก หลักหลายพันเลยทีเดียว

ยกตัวอย่าง plugin ที่นิยมนำมาใช้เช่น
- LESS (grunt-contrib-less)ใช้ในการคอมไพล์ LESS ให้เป็น CSS
- Compress CSS files (grunt-contrib-cssmin)ใช้ในการลดขนาดไฟล์ css
- Uglify (grunt-contrib-uglify)ใช้ในการลดขนาดไฟล์ javascript
- Minify images (grunt-contrib-imagemin)ใช้ในการลดขนาดรูปภาพ
.. เป็นต้น

plugin เหล่านี้ถ้านำมาใช้ดีๆ จะทำให้ code ของเราได้ HTML ที่ clean
และไม่มีไฟล์ขยะที่ไม่ได้ใช้ติดมา ทำให้โหลดเร็ว Performance พุ่งแน่นอน

ลองดูเพิ่มเติมได้ที่ : http://gruntjs.com
ส่วน plugin มีให้โหลดใน github เยอะมาก


ถ้าชอบบทความนี้ กด Like เลย :Grunt js คืออะไร หาคำตอบได้ที่นี่
TAGS : Javascript   Programming   MEAN Stack   Node JS   Grunt JS  
 1,902 view  หมวดหมู่ : สำหรับโปรแกรมเมอร์  วันที่สร้าง : 30/09/2015



SOA,Java,XSLT

 ร่วมแสดงความคิดเห็นได้ที่นี่

#1.    เอก
@ Grunt.js กับ glup.js สองตัวนี้คล้ายๆ กันครับ
Grunt.js ออกมาก่อน มี plugin ให้ใช้เยอะกว่า
ส่วน glup.js ส่วนตัวผมว่าใช้ง่ายกว่านะครับ แต่ plugin ยังน้อยอยู่

...............................................



× แจ้งเตือน! เราสนับสนุนทุกความคิดเห็น ที่ ใช้ถ้อยคำสุภาพ ไม่ละเมิดผู้อื่น ไม่ก่อให้เกิดความขัดแย้ง

เนื้อหาที่เกี่ยวช้อง

  Oracle Create Select สร้าง Table ใหม่ตามโครงสร้าง Table เดิม ถามเมื่อ (2013-07-23)   2,231 views  (ดูล่าสุดเมื่อ 2 นาที)

  Java export Excel ด้วย Apache poi Merge column แล้วข้อมูลหาย ถามเมื่อ (2015-09-14)   1,822 views  (ดูล่าสุดเมื่อ 26 นาที)

  XSL คืออะไร ต่างจาก CSS ยังไง ทำความรู้จักกับ XSL ในการจัดรูปแบบ XML ถามเมื่อ (2014-05-27)   3,466 views  (ดูล่าสุดเมื่อ 27 นาที)

  inode บน unix คืออะไร ถามเมื่อ (2020-02-04)   2,138 views  (ดูล่าสุดเมื่อ 27 นาที)

  Full Stack JavaScript คืออะไร ถามเมื่อ (2020-01-24)   1,957 views  (ดูล่าสุดเมื่อ 27 นาที)

  Agile Software Development คืออะไรครับ ถามเมื่อ (2012-08-30)   3,224 views  (ดูล่าสุดเมื่อ 52 นาที)

  Spring Boot คืออะไร ต่างจาก Spring Framework ยังไง ถามเมื่อ (2018-12-21)   4,332 views  (ดูล่าสุดเมื่อ 53 นาที)

  CodePro สุดยอด tools แห่ง code coverage ถามเมื่อ (2013-07-12)   2,515 views  (ดูล่าสุดเมื่อ 83 นาที)

  Java JSON simple สร้างและ Parser JSON ง่ายๆ ผ่าน JSONParser บน ถามเมื่อ (2015-08-27)   1,948 views  (ดูล่าสุดเมื่อ 96 นาที)

  Angular select set selected อย่างไร ถามเมื่อ (2019-06-01)   1,232 views  (ดูล่าสุดเมื่อ 98 นาที)


 

บ้านเดียวกันดอทคอม เว็บถามตอบ รวมทุกเรื่องที่คุณอยากรู้ ให้ความรู้ ความบันเทิง มีสาระ
www.ban1gun.com